Introduction to ERP and SAP
Defining Key Terms
Enterprise Resource Planning (ERP) refers to a type of software that organizations use to manage and integrate the crucial parts of their businesses. An ERP software system can integrate planning, purchasing inventory, sales, marketing, finance, human resources, and more into a single system. This integration helps streamline processes and information across the organization.
SAP, which stands for Systems, Applications, and Products in Data Processing, is one of the leading providers of ERP software. Founded in 1972 in Germany, SAP has grown to become a global leader in enterprise applications, offering a suite of solutions that cater to various business needs. The SAP ERP system is designed to facilitate the flow of information between all business functions inside the boundaries of the organization and manage the connections to outside stakeholders.

Exploring the Mechanics of ERP Systems
How ERP Systems Work
At its core, an ERP system functions as a centralized hub that integrates various business processes and data into a unified platform. Here’s how it typically operates:
1. Data Centralization : ERP systems collect data from different departments—such as finance, HR, sales, and supply chain—into a single database. This centralization ensures that all departments have access to the same information, which reduces discrepancies and errors.
2. Modular Architecture : Most ERP systems, including SAP, are modular. This means organizations can implement specific modules tailored to their needs, such as finance, inventory management, or customer relationship management (CRM). Each module can communicate with others, ensuring seamless data flow.
3. Real-time Processing : ERP systems process data in real-time, allowing businesses to access up-to-date information. This capability is crucial for decision-making, as it enables organizations to react swiftly to changes in the market or internal operations.
4. User Interface : Modern ERP systems feature user-friendly interfaces that allow employees to interact with the software easily. Dashboards and reporting tools provide insights into performance metrics, helping users monitor key performance indicators (KPIs).
5. Automation : By automating routine tasks such as order processing, invoicing, and payroll, ERP systems reduce manual effort and the potential for human error. This automation leads to increased efficiency and allows employees to focus on higher-value tasks.

Limitations of ERP Systems
Despite their advantages, ERP systems also have limitations:
– Complexity : Implementing an ERP system can be complex and time-consuming. Organizations may face challenges in data migration, system integration, and user training.
– Customization Challenges : While ERP systems can be customized to some extent, excessive customization can lead to increased costs and complications during upgrades.
– Vendor Lock-In : Relying on a specific ERP vendor can create challenges if the organization wishes to switch systems in the future. Migrating data and processes to a new system can be a daunting task.
